P0130/P0134 = Bad upstream O2 sensor

As for the ABS light... Have you been working under the hood lately? Maybe you knocked the wires? Other than that, I don't know of any way to troubleshoot an ABS system w/ some pricey tools.

well I fixed the problem. I guese somewere I must have pisse off a little furry animal cuses what ever it was ate the wires for the 02 sencer and ate and took a 8in section of the ABS wire that runs just underneth the wipers. I guse they needed it more than I did . the o2 sencer is just a quick fix im going to get a new one. anyone Know the Part# for the front o2 sencer?
